a note on fluxbox styles:
most of the fluxbox styles are part of the fluxbox package. so to remove them, fluxbox will need to be repackaged. I presume you will want to have a separate build of fluxbox for mx25, as otherwise you could remove a theme in use already on mx23.
we already package fluxbox ourselves, so I doubt its a huge deal. Just mentioning it.
